Truce takes maintain in Aleppo but combating goes on some place else in Syria

Civil defense members work at a site hit by an airstrike in the rebel held area of Aleppo's Baedeen district, Syria, May 3, 2016. REUTERS/Abdalrhman Ismail

A cessation of hostilities agreement brokered through Russia and the united states introduced a measureof alleviation to the battered Syrian metropolis of Aleppo on Thursday but President Bashar al-Assad statedhe still sought a complete, crushing victory over riot forces.

Syrian kingdom media said the navy could abide by a “regime of calm” inside the city that got here intoimpact at 1 a.m. (6.00 p.m. ET on Wednesday) for forty eight hours, and relative calm prevailed on Thursday morning after two weeks of loss of life and destruction.

The army blamed Islamist insurgents for violating the agreement in a single day by what it known asindiscriminate shelling of a few government-held residential regions of divided Aleppo. but residents saidthe violence had eased with the aid of morning and extra shops had opened up.

somewhere else in Syria, combating persevered. Islamic nation militants captured the Shaer gasdiscipline in jap Syria on Thursday, the primary advantage for the hardline jihadists within the Palmyradesert place on the grounds that they misplaced the historical town in March, in line with rebellionsources and a screen.

Assad stated he could accept not anything much less than an outright victory against rebels in Aleppo and throughout Syria, state media pronounced.

In a telegram sent to Russian President Vladimir Putin thanking Moscow for its army support, Assad statedthe military changed into set on “attaining very last victory” and “crushing the aggression” in its fightagainst the rebels.

The British-primarily based Syrian Observatory for Human Rights said as a minimum one character waskilled in revolt shelling overnight of the Midan neighborhood at the authorities aspect of Aleppo, whichbecome Syria’s industrial hub and largest city before the warfare.

Rockets additionally hit the new Aleppo district, state media stated.but a resident of the rebellion-held japa part of the city said that even though warplanes flew in a single day, there have been none of the extreme raids seen at some stage in the past 10 days of air strikes.

humans in several districts ventured out onto the streets in which greater stores than normal had opened, the resident of al Shaar neighborhood said.

any other resident stated civilians in several districts sensed a wellknown trend in the direction of calm.

“From remaining night it become positive and my wife went out to keep and shops opened and thosebreathed. We did not hear the shelling and bombing we had gotten conversant in,” Sameh Tutunji, aservice provider stated.

A rebellion supply additionally said that no matter intermittent firing throughout the metropolis‘sprimary the front traces, fighting had subsided and no army shelling of residential regions have beenheard.

The best intense preventing mentioned changed into inside the southern Aleppo nation-state close tothe metropolis of Khan Touman, wherein Syria’s al Qaeda offshoot Nusra front is dug in near whereIranian-backed militias hold a stronghold, a rebel source said.

Rebels additionally said government helicopters dropped barrel bombs on riot-held Dahyat al-Rashdeen al Junobi, northwest of Aleppo, and near the Jamiyat al Zahraa region, which noticed a revolt floor attackpushed again on Wednesday. [L5N1812KR]

IS seize gas subject

The latest surge in bloodshed in Aleppo had wrecked the first essential cessation of hostilities settlement of the five12 monthsvintage battle, sponsored by way of Washington and Moscow, backers of the rivalsides, which had held due to the fact that February.

A spokesman for the mainstream opposition said the Saudi-primarily based high Negotiations Committee supported the deal however desired the truce to cover all of Syria, not just Aleppo. It accused thegovernment of violating it.

Nusra and the Islamic nation fighters aren’t protected in any U.N.- brokered deal for a cessation of hostilities.

In different regions of Syrian, at least six human beings had been killed and ratings wounded in a villageinside the japanese Homs nation-state, in which Islamic kingdom militants function, whilst a suicide bomber blew himself up, state media stated.

Amaq, an IS-affiliated information employer, said Islamic country militants had taken over the Shaer gasfield and its facility in Palmyra, killing at least 30 Syrian troops stationed there and seizing heavy weapons, tanks and missiles.

Russian battle jets have been also suggested to have struck militant hideouts in the metropolis of Sukhnawithin the same Palmyra barren region place.
